At the heart of Creek Connections is a collaboration between Allegheny College and schools in western Pennsylvania and New York for the purpose of encouraging natural science education through hands-on field and laboratory experiences. Creek Connections has forged an effective partnership between Allegheny College and regional K-12 schools to turn waterways in Northwest Pennsylvania, Southwest New

York, and the Pittsburgh area into outdoor environmental laboratories. Emphasizing a hands-on, inquiry based investigation of local waterways, this project annually involves over 40 different secondary schools and the classes of 50 teachers

Today wrapped up three days of Roam the Refuge for Penncrest School District 4th graders with French Creek Valley Conservancy and hosted at Erie National Wildlife Refuge along with several other partner organizations. Here are a few of the aquatic macroinvertebrates students discovered and identified.

In the wake of the largest sewage spill in US history, American Rivers declares that the Potomac is America's Most Endangered River. In addition to the threat of aging wastewater infrastructure, the Potomac watershed is also home to the largest concentration of data centers in the world.
